Track your income, sales, payouts and certificates from the Earnings section of your Zinner Dashboard.
Accessing Your Earnings
Open your Zinner Dashboard and go to
Earnings:
https://zinnhub.com/dashboard/zinner/earnings/. Use the period filter at the top (choose a year and month, then click
Apply) to view any timeframe.
You Are the Merchant of Record
An important thing to understand: on Zinn Hub,
you are the merchant of recordfor your sales. Your gross sales are your revenue, and Zinn Hub charges a platform service fee on top. That means
you are responsible for your own tax collection, remittance and reporting. Use the figures here and the CSV export for your own accounts and bookkeeping.
The Four Tabs
Your Earnings section is split into four tabs:
📊 Overview
Your headline figures for the selected period:
- Gross sales— the total your buyers paid
- Your earnings— your share after the platform service fee
- Platform fees— Zinn Hub's service fee for the period
- Refund rate— the share of gross that was refunded
Below that,
Earnings by sourcebreaks your activity down across
Zinns,
Projectsand
Custom Offers, showing the number of orders, gross sales and your earnings for each, with a combined total.
🧾 Sales
A per-order statement of every sale in the period — date, order, type, buyer, gross, tax, any refund, the platform fee and the processor fee, down to your net. You can
download it as a CSVfor your accountant or your own records.
💸 Payouts
Your payout history and how it reconciles against your sales, so you can see exactly what's been paid out for the period. (To request or manage payouts and payout methods, use the
Payoutsand
Payment Setupsections of your dashboard.)
🎖️ Certificates
Download your
Registered Verified Zinn Hub Sellercertificate — a credential confirming you're a verified seller on the platform. It becomes available once your verification is complete.
Understanding the Numbers
- Gross salesis what the buyer paid.
- Your earningsis your share after Zinn Hub's platform service fee. This is shown- *before*payout processor fees (PayPal, card or crypto), which are listed per order on the- Salestab.
- Platform feesis Zinn Hub's service fee, which reflects your current commission tier or membership plan. You can see the plans and rates at- https://zinnhub.com/packages/.
Exporting for Your Accounts
Because you're the merchant of record, keeping your own records matters. You can export your data to CSV from the Sales tab for tax purposes, personal accounting or business analysis — everything you need is here, ready whenever you want it.
Key Metrics to Watch
- Revenue trends— are your earnings growing, and which months are strongest?
- Order volume— how many orders are you receiving, and is it rising?
- Average order value— what's your typical sale, and can you increase it?
- Earnings by source— are your sales coming from Zinns, Projects or Custom Offers, and where's the opportunity?
Using Your Data to Improve
- Low sales?Review your pricing, improve your listings, or add new services.
- High refunds?Tighten your communication and set clearer expectations upfront.
- One source dominating?Lean into what's working — if Custom Offers convert well, make them easy to request.
- Seasonal patterns?Plan promotions around your strongest periods.
